1864 SENSIBLE BTUH @ 55F.CellarPro 1800H-ECX Cooling Unit (P/N 25544). CellarPro’s 1800H-ECX cooling unit (1/4 Ton Nominal) is the first cooling unit designed specifically forshallow-depthglass-enclosed wine cellars, and uses energy-efficient variable-speed EC fans for maximum performance.

Just 10 1/2-inches deep and 10-inches tall, with both cold-side airflows at the bottom of the cooling unit, the 1800H-ECX Houdini is designed to sit inside or atop the cellar and “disappear” within the cellar. Dual independent variable-speed fans offer flexibility to trade-off between super-quiet operation vs maximum performance.

All air-cooled refrigeration equipment requires fresh air intake to dissipate the heat generated by the cooling unit. The fresh air intake CANNOT come from the wine cellar space – it must come from space outside the cellar.

Features include:

  • Shallow height and depth

    • Fits shallow glass enclosures
    • 10 1/2″D x 10″H
    • 36 1/2″W
  • Can be placed inside the cellar, atop the cellar, partially installed in the cellar ceiling, or completely remote from the cellar and ducted.
  • When not ducted:
    • Choice of airflows for cold side
      • Intake from bottom or left side
      • Exhaust from bottom or front side
      • Air deflector optional
    • Choice of airflows for hot side:
      • Intake from top or right side
      • Exhaust from the rear or the top side (the top exhaust offers 2 orientations)
      • Air deflector optional
  • When Ducted
    • Choice of airflows for the cold side:
      • Up to 50 equivalent feet (25′ per duct) with required 8-inch insulated ducting
      • Intake from the left / exhaust from the front
      • High fan speed required for ducted installations
      • Auxilary fans should never be used on the cold side
    • Choice of airflows for the hot side:
      • Up to 50 equivalent feet (25′ per duct) and 85F maximum intake temperature (no auxiliary fan required) with required 6-inch ducting
      • With an auxiliary inline fan, up to 100 equivalent feet (50′ per duct) and 95F maximum intake temperature
      • Intake and exhaust from the top
      • High fan speed required for ducted installations
    • When ducting a Houdini cooling unit:

      • Our OEM duct hoodsmustbe used, otherwise our warranty will be voided
      • The HIGH fan speedsmustbe used
  • When not ducted, thecondenser fan settingdepends on the ambient temperature
    • Low fan speed (49 dBA): 85F maximum intake temperature
    • High fan speed: (55 dBA): 95F maximum intake temperature
    • If ducted, the high fan speed must always be used
  • When not ducted, theevaporator fan settingdepends on the following conditions:
    • Higher cooling loads from warmer ambient temperatures require high fan speed
    • Lower setpoint / colder desired cellar temperature requires high fan speed
    • Sensible BTUH @ 55F on low fan speed is 1456 BTUH, and 51F is the lowest achievable cellar temperature
    • Sensible BTUH @ 55F on high fan speed is 1864 BTUH, and 47F is the lowest achievable cellar temperature
  • Energy-efficient variable-speed EC fans with independent controls – choose between performance vs noise
  • Oversized stainless-steel drain pan with 100W heating element
    • Drain line not required for properly constructed, airtight cellars
    • Condensate Drain Line: strongly recommended for wine cellar installations that are not airtight, the drain line allows excess moisture to drain from the the cooling unit(1606).
    • NOTE: If the cellar is not properly constructed and airtight, our warranty does not cover damage from excess condensation, even when the condensate drain line is added to equipment.
  • 110V Power source:
    • Choice of side or rear
    • Removable 10-ft cord
  • Bottle probe for use in liquid MUST be used with Houdinis

    • The HY setting on the cooling unit must be changed to 1
    • We recommend using the probe filled with water and 10% rubbing alcohol to keep the water from developing mold
    • The bottle with the probe should be located inside the cellar, near the top of the cellar, in a central location with good airflow (ie not buried in the racks nor in a corner)
